1. Classic Florals: Nature’s Own Fashion Statement 🌸

Floral patterns on silk scarves are as classic as a white t-shirt. These designs often evoke a sense of romance and sophistication, perfect for adding a touch of femininity to any outfit. Whether it’s delicate roses or bold peonies, floral motifs have a timeless quality that transcends seasons and trends. They’re a nod to nature’s beauty and a reminder of the elegance found in simplicity.

2. Geometric Designs: Where Math Meets Fashion 🔳

For those who prefer a more modern look, geometric patterns offer a fresh twist on traditional silk scarves. Triangles, squares, and circles in vibrant colors can add a pop of energy to any ensemble. These patterns are inspired by everything from ancient mosaics to contemporary graphic design, making them a versatile choice for fashion-forward individuals. They’re proof that sometimes, less is more – especially when it comes to clean lines and bold shapes.

3. Cultural Symbols: Wearing a Story 📜

Silk scarves often feature patterns that tell a story, drawing inspiration from various cultures around the world. Whether it’s the intricate paisley designs of India or the tribal prints of Africa, these scarves are not just accessories; they’re a way to celebrate diversity and cultural heritage. By wearing a scarf with these symbols, you’re not only accessorizing but also honoring the rich tapestry of global traditions.
